description Piracy has been perceived as a menace of times long gone and has until recently been associated with romantic tales of one-legged and free-spirited men, roving the Caribbean Sea for bounty and gold. In recent years, however, a new type of pirate has emerged in one of the most lawless spots in the world. The pirates of Somalia increasingly threaten one of the busiest commercial shipping routes, thus forcing shipowners to pay higher insurance premiums or to reroute around the Cape. Either way, the current situation tremendously increases the costs of shipping in the Indian Ocean and threatens life of seamen.
